Gerber Homogenized Carrot Baby Food

Finely homogenized pure carrot preparation in a 113g jar for retail sale as infant food. Meets subheading 2005.10 criteria with net weight under 250g, suitable for young children, allowing minor seasoning. Classified under 2005.10.00.00 as homogenized vegetables put up for infant retail consumption.

Import Tips & Compliance

Verify net weight ≤250g per container and retail infant food labeling to qualify under 2005.10 precedence

Provide lab analysis confirming homogenization (finely pureed) and minimal non-vegetable additives
